Having been involved with numerous contracts over the years, it is somewhat surprising why Employer's and their advisers continue to select the JCT and NEC suite of Contracts to the extent that it appears, on the face of it, that these standard forms dominate the England and Welsh construction market.

There are other forms out there and I'm interested to hear of peoples experiences with these other forms such as the CIOB Time and Cost Management Contract [see attachment below], PPC suite, ICC Infrastructure Conditions of Contract etc.

FIDIC for its part is predominantly used Internationally but it is understood that this form has been used in England on for example, the London Gateway Port project and other specialist contracts such as the IChemE are commonly used for process plant facilities.
